Height Of Cricket Nets. The back and side walls are 3m high. Mcc laws state the height of cricket stumps should be 28in above the ground and the combined width of all three stumps should be 9in. Generally practice cricket nets are 20m long and 3.6m wide. This usually means ensuring the batting end is a minimum of 35ft in length and 12ft in width. Whilst the dimensions of the nets vary, there should be enough room for the batsmen and bowlers to play as if they were in a match.
